Lipschitz, Rudolf

German mathematician; born May 14, 1832, at Königsberg, East Prussia; died at Bonn Oct. 8, 1903. Educated at his native town (Ph.D. 1853), he established himself in 1857 as privat-docent in the University of Bonn, becoming professor of mathematics in the University of Breslau in 1862, and in that of Bonn in 1864.
Lipschitz was the author of: "Wissenschaft und Staat," Bonn, 1874; "Die Bedeutung der Theoretischen Mechanik," Berlin, 1876; "Lehrbuch der Analysis," Bonn, 1877-80; "Untersuchungen über die Summen von Quadraten," ib. 1886.
